Transaction 64a5391c1e0773ba8e51067892099b94c0005d9a467d7df5d247eb74ae84fea6
1 Input
1 Output
-
64a5391c1e0773ba8e51067892099b94c0005d9a467d7df5d247eb74ae84fea6:0
- value
- 399016
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9cca1f5c9dd165dfe726ab6708751226d50c4969 OP_EQUAL
- address
- 3Fz3UBpHRtUvLPo8i4V3WA6jWAhq83hNxw